Air pollution control and enterprise competitiveness - A re-examination based on China's Clean Air Action

Abstract:
The "Air Pollution Prevention and Control Action Plan" is regarded as China's war against air pollution, which is also noted as China's Clean Air Action (CAA policy). Although abundant studies have focused on the impact of CAA policy on social activities, such as air quality, pollutants emission, and economic output, limited studies explore its impact on enterprise competitiveness from a more micro perspective. Improving total factor productivity (TFP) is essential to achieve economic efficiency and sustainable development. Identifying the impact and influence mechanism of the CAA policy on TFP is important for China to realize the coordinated development of environment and economy and promote high-quality economic development. Based on the difference-in-differences model, this paper evaluates the impact of the CAA policy on enterprise productivity. The empirical analysis shows that there is a significantly negative effect from the CAA policy to the TFP of polluting enterprises, indicating that the CAA policy has decreased enterprise productivity. Our finding is robust, after conducting several robustness tests, such as replacing different dependent indicators, adopting different policy measurement variables, considering other policy interventions and using propensity score matching. Besides, this paper also discusses the possible heterogeneities. This paper adds additional empirical evidence to understand the relationship between air pollution control and enterprise competitiveness. The conclusions of this paper have important practical significance for China to further promote air pollution control and perfect the environmental control system.
